Find a Lawyer in MarsaxlokkAbout Medical Malpractice Law in Marsaxlokk, Malta:
Medical malpractice refers to situations where a healthcare provider fails to provide proper treatment or care to a patient, resulting in harm or injury. In Marsaxlokk, Malta, medical malpractice cases are governed by specific laws and regulations to protect the rights of patients who have been affected by negligent medical practices.

Local Laws Overview:
In Malta, medical malpractice cases are regulated by the Maltese Civil Code and the Maltese Medical Council Act. These laws establish the standard of care that healthcare providers are expected to fulfill and outline the legal procedures for filing a medical malpractice claim. It is important to understand these laws to protect your rights in a medical malpractice case.
Frequently Asked Questions:
1. What is considered medical malpractice in Marsaxlokk, Malta?
Medical malpractice in Marsaxlokk is when a healthcare provider deviates from the standard of care, resulting in harm or injury to a patient.
2. How long do I have to file a medical malpractice claim in Marsaxlokk?
In Malta, the general time limit to file a medical malpractice claim is two years from the date of the incident or when the harm was discovered.
3. What damages can I recover in a medical malpractice case?
You may be able to recover compensation for medical expenses, lost income, pain and suffering, and other related damages in a medical malpractice case.
4. Do I need to prove negligence to win a medical malpractice case?
Yes, you need to establish that the healthcare provider was negligent in providing care, deviating from the standard of care expected in similar circumstances.
5. Can I file a complaint with the Medical Council of Malta for medical malpractice?
Yes, you can file a complaint with the Medical Council of Malta if you believe a healthcare provider has engaged in malpractice. The Council can investigate and take disciplinary action against the provider if necessary.
6. What role does expert testimony play in a medical malpractice case?
Expert testimony is often used to establish the standard of care and to demonstrate how the healthcare provider deviated from that standard, leading to harm or injury.
7. Can I settle a medical malpractice case out of court?
Yes, you can reach a settlement with the healthcare provider or their insurance company outside of court to resolve a medical malpractice case.
8. What are the potential challenges of proving a medical malpractice case in Marsaxlokk, Malta?
Proving a medical malpractice case can be challenging due to the need for expert testimony, complex medical evidence, and potential resistance from the healthcare provider's legal team.
